In this episode of Christianly, we tackle the ongoing debate about church size and structure. While large churches have existed since the early church (think Jerusalem, Spurgeon, and even Antioch), the modern megachurch often follows an attractional model—raising concerns about biblical fidelity, church growth methods, and spiritual maturity.
